Clarity Healthcare (MO)

4066 Dunnica Ave St. Louis, MO 63116

Nestled in St. Louis, Clarity Healthcare provides comprehensive care for those dealing with substance use issues, offering both detoxification services and treatment for co-occurring mental health illnesses or serious emotional disturbances. Their focus is on empowering adults on their journey towards balanced health. Various payment methods are accepted at Clarity Healthcare including Federal funding options, medicaid, federal military insurance (e.g., tricare), private health insurance, and cash or self-payment to support accessibility. At Clarity Healthcare, the expert team is dedicated to providing quality care in a compassionate setting.
